We are policing a protest outside the Royal Courts of Justice following the appeal on the proscription of Palestine Action. Updates will be posted on this thread.

So far, officers have made 58 arrests for supporting a proscribed organisation. Further arrests are under way. A short section of the Strand, between Aldwych and the Royal Courts of Justice, has been closed to allow officers to safely make arrests.

The protest outside the Royal Courts of Justice has concluded. Officers made a total of 117 arrests for expressing support for a proscribed organisation. A short section of the Strand, between Aldwych and the Royal Courts of Justice, is now fully reopened. Separately, colleagues from @CityPolice made two arrests for support of a proscribed organisation at a protest at the Old Bailey.

A total of 14 arrests (correction from earlier 15) were made during today’s policing operation: Five for violent disorder (one person also arrested for assault on an emergency worker) Six for Section 4a Public Order Act offences (four of those for racial/religiously aggravated matters) One for Section 18 Public Order Act offences One for assault on an emergency worker One for common assault. Those arrested have been taken into custody.

Nine years on from the Grenfell Tower tragedy, the thoughts of us all at the Met are with those who lost loved ones, those who survived and all those affected. They have our commitment the Met’s complex and diligent criminal investigation into the fire continues. We are on track to submit all files to the Crown Prosecution Service by the end of September so they can make charging decisions.
The Met’s investigation into the Grenfell Tower fire is on track to submit all files for charging decisions to the Crown Prosecution Service by the end of September. @CPSUK are confident they can make those decisions by the 10th anniversary of the tragedy. Deputy Assistant Commissioner Kevin Southworth talks about this important milestone and how we are supporting the bereaved families and survivors through the next steps.

To ensure tomorrow’s Trooping the Colour passes off without serious disruption and with minimal disturbance to horses at the event, we have imposed conditions on those taking part in the Republic protest.
